Is the Weather Good on Mars?

The weather on Mars is extremely harsh. The average temperature is approximately minus 60 degrees Celsius (minus 76 degrees Fahrenheit), but it can vary from minus 125 degrees Celsius (minus 195 degrees Fahrenheit) at the poles during winter to 20 degrees Celsius (68 degrees Fahrenheit) at lower latitudes in the Martian summer. The atmosphere, composed mainly of carbon dioxide, is very thin, which means that the atmospheric pressure at the surface of Mars is only 1% of that of Earth. This thin atmosphere also offers little protection against solar and cosmic radiation, posing a significant challenge for future crewed missions.

NASA's Curiosity rover has been exploring Mars for nearly a decade, sending us data and discoveries. Recently, it captured an image that appears to show a door carved into a rock formation, generating great interest on social media and forums like Reddit. However, geologists offer a more down-to-earth explanation: this "door" is a natural formation caused by Martian earthquakes, known as 'marsquakes,' which are common on the Red Planet. These seismic events create fractures in the rock, forming openings like the one captured by Curiosity.

NASA has explained that this type of open fracture is common both on Mars and on Earth. The phenomenon of 'pareidolia,' the tendency of the human brain to recognize familiar patterns in ambiguous shapes, also plays a role in how we interpret these images. What appears to be a door is simply a natural geological formation that our brains interpret as something more significant.

Mars has been the subject of numerous optical illusions in the past. In 2010, an image showed what seemed to be rows of trees over dunes, but in reality, they were flat structures of basaltic sands that sublimate into vapor under the Martian sun. The Opportunity rover captured a rock that resembled the outline of a gorilla, and Curiosity has photographed other curious formations, such as one that looked like a crab in 2015 and another that resembled a giant mouse in the same year. All of these are optical illusions that highlight the human tendency to seek familiarity in the unknown.
